So i have a 2001 ford taurus with the 3.0L v6. last night it was making a noise so i popped the hood and see a liquid all over the place on the passenger side of the engine bay well i check the coolant resavoir and its empty, also my heater is not working all of sudden it just blows out cold air like the A/C and i know that means there is no coolant flowing through the lines, so then i fill it up with water to see were the leak is and the water seems to not even be circulating through the system it just sits in the resavoir and tries to boil over if i loosen the cap a little, i think it may be a bad water pump i checked the weep hole on it and it looks like this
